Salinas Union High School District starts school Wednesday. It s a long time coming for thousands of students and staff. Students in the district are coming back full-time if they want to.The concerns, anxiety of the pandemic are still there but so is the thrill to learn in a classroom again. It is a monumentous task. There are just so many moving parts, said Kati Bassler, Salinas Valley Federation of Teachers president.It s setting up the desks in the classrooms, learning how to share space to figuring out how to enforce COVID-19 protocols.On Wednesday, 16,500 students are expected to return to in-person learning five days a week at Salinas Union High School District. Masks will be required for all inside, while outside is optional. Face coverings cannot include bandanas or neck gators.Bassler said, there will be a lot of challenges but that s life. A former Salinas High biology teacher is charged with having sex with a 17-year-old girl for the second time in six years.
Juan Govea was charged with felony sexual assault on a minor, five years after charges of unlawful sexual intercourse with the same minor were dismissed after victim refused to testify.
According to a 2017 interview with the Monterey County DA s Office, prosecutors are allowed two dismissals in a felony case, which opened up the door for the woman at the center of the case to change her mind down the road.
Now, new charges have been filed regarding his relationship with the same minor: Two counts of oral copulation with a minor.

As reported by the New York Post, on June 23rd, Hayward Unified School District’s board of trustees cast a unanimous vote.
The Bay Area board approved a mandatory “ethnic studies” program based on Critical Race Theory.
It’s the state’s first such required curriculum covering every grade level including preschool.
